Vaco by Highspring is seeking a strategic Revenue Cycle Manager to lead operations on-site in Louisville, KY. This direct hire role is designed to provide executive-level direction for all revenue cycle functions, ensuring the financial health and operational efficiency of the organization. The position serves as a critical bridge between clinical operations and financial performance, overseeing the entire patient financial journey from access to final reimbursement.
In this capacity, you will drive the strategic vision for revenue integrity, working to optimize cash flow and minimize denials while maintaining strict compliance with federal and payer regulations. You will lead a team dedicated to fostering a culture of accountability and continuous improvement, utilizing data-driven insights to refine workflows and enhance system capabilities. This is a leadership position focused on transforming revenue cycle operations through process improvement, technology adoption, and strong financial stewardship.
